Transaction 14aab877c656b8437a8e348b72d59d07e3b34e5cd919fd71bcfef38faafe26a1
1 Input
1 Output
-
14aab877c656b8437a8e348b72d59d07e3b34e5cd919fd71bcfef38faafe26a1:0
- value
- 3159552
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 0bf21b2dfe1963579bcd91253e8a646f23990eba OP_EQUALVERIFY OP_CHECKSIG
- address
- 126ATwd7h6WWLCcL441ermPgPLjoEHdTwi